what pjstoneson said is accurate -- (presuming you signed up in all the places you needed to)
just for being a member with current contact info, you got an adventure (village of homlet, or something like that).
AND if you DMed to earn 5 rewards points during the first half of 2009 then you also got the ship tiles

so if you want the tiles, at this point you'll have to buy/trade from someone else.

there will be some other reward next year (no announcement yet as to what that will be).

I've just joined the RPGA, and I DM for my group weekly at home. I sanctioned last week's game for the first time...what do I need to do next to get credit for DMing, and how do I do it?

You will need to make sure all your players have RPGA numbers. If they don't have them, they can sign up online. After the game, go back to the DCI/RPGA website, log on and click on "Report Event". From there it will take you through a series of steps about reporting your game. You must have at least 4 RPGA players at the game to make it valid.
